Drug Addiction and the Enabler

It is not uncommon in most cases of addiction in Hampshire that the individual's habit is made possible fully or in part by someone in their immediate environment. An enabler is either a knowing or unknowing participant in the individuals struggle with drug addiction, and is someone who makes their addiction possible or easier to prolong. The act of enabling is usually carried out out of "concern" or "worry", but is more harmful than good in the end. A good example of an enabler is a family member or partner who provides an addicted individual any kind of money, housing, transportation, and may even help the person to get their drugs in some way. The thinking behind this is often that the enabling is helping the person to be in a safe and stable scenario, rather than being on the streets or in harmful situations.

Enablers are often the vital component in an addicted individual's life which makes addiction possible. Reversely, enablers can also be the key to helping someone get off of drugs by discontinuing the enabling behaviors. As soon as the enabling has been stopped, the addict will often realize that it is no longer possible to continue their habit and will reach a crisis point. This is why an enabler must recognize the situation immediately and instead of prolonging the individual's addiction, get them into an effective drug rehab center in Hampshire. Only then will both the enabler and the drug addict be able to go on with their lives in a much healthier and sane manner.

Drug Addiction and Codependency

Drug addiction and codependency go hand in hand, and a lot of family members and loved one's of addicts in Hampshire find themselves enthralled in an addicted individual's addiction. This can go so far that it reaches the level where the codependency is an addiction in itself. Addiction at times leads to both the drug addicted individual and those closest to them to create these harmful codependent relationships, which can lead to great mental pain and eventually ruin these relationships completely. Codependency can be hard to recover from, especially when those affected forget how to operate normally in the relationship and become fully absorbed in drug addiction and its effects.

The only way to stop and recover from drug addiction and codependency is to seek out treatment at a drug rehab facility. Many times, it is not only required for the individual who is actually using drugs to look for treatment, but also for the people in their lives who have become codependent to find treatment as well. There are numerous drug rehab programs in Hampshire which not only deal with drug addiction but unhealthy codependency, which can help repair these relationships and prepare friends and family for a much more healthy relationship once treatment is completed.

How Much Does a Drug Rehab Cost?

It can be difficult enough to get someone to want help and agree to enter a drug rehabilitation facility in Hampshire. Digging up the money to pay for drug rehab can sometimes be a challenge, but one that can be overcome if one looks at the many possibilities available in Hampshire. Depending on which drug rehab option is chosen, the cost of drug rehabilitation can vary considerably from program to program. Some outpatient and short term drug rehabilitation programscenters]]] for example may be state or federally funded and may even be free of charge. These types of facilities are also usually the least effective however, a fact which should be considered over cost.

More long term drug treatment centers in Hampshire which have proven to be the most effective are residential and inpatient drug treatment programs which require a stay of at least 90 days. These types of drug treatment programs are normally more costly due to the fact that these facilities are private drug rehab centers and provide their clients with all food and shelter for the duration of their stay. These programs typically cost anywhere from $4000 to $20,000, depending on the amenities offered and length of stay.

Drug Rehab and Detox for Withdrawal Symptoms

One of the reasons drug addicted individuals find it difficult to stop using drugs once they start using them, is because of physical and psychological dependency that inevitably occurs if the individual uses them long enough. It no longer seems to be a matter of "willpower" because their bodies and minds will actually punish them both physically and mentally when they try to stop using drugs. This is called drug withdrawal, and is a major roadblock for those who want to stop using drugs. Individuals often become very ill during withdrawal and can even die in certain types withdrawal, because seizures and strokes can occur with certain drugs and with alcohol. Depression is a very typical withdrawal symptom, which can become so severe that an individual may commit suicide.

To alleviate certain withdrawal symptoms and to make detoxification a safer process, it is important that addicts who wish to quit do so in the proper environment such as a drug rehabilitation facility. Drug rehabilitation programs in Hampshire can not only medically monitor the person through the detoxification process and help alleviate and relieve withdrawal symptoms, but also ensure that the individual doesn't relapse back into drug use. After detoxification has been accomplished, treatment professionals in Hampshire will then ensure that all underlying psychological and emotional issues tied to the individual's addiction are confronted and resolved so that they stay off of drugs once they leave the drug rehabilitation program.

How Long is a Drug Rehab Program in Hampshire?

People progress through Drug Rehab in Hampshire at different rates, so there is no way that an exact pre-determined length for recovery can be set .However, research has proven unequivocally that the recovery success rate is much higher in long term residential Drug Rehabilitation than in short term drug rehabilitation. Generally, for residential or outpatient Drug Rehab in Hampshire, participation for less than 90 days offers a very limited amount of effectiveness, and treatment lasting longer is advised for achieving the most positive results. The reason that a longer duration of drug treatment is highly recommended is because it takes time to physically rejuvenate from drugs and lower drug cravings. It also takes time for the addict's brain to begin to heal. A longer Drug Rehab Program in Hampshire, TN. also gives the addict time to be able to sort out the underlying issues of why they began to use drugs in the first place. Long term Drug Rehabilitation is recommended because it takes time for the addict to adopt new behaviors and skills and to be educated in relapse prevention. In terms of how long a Drug Treatment Program in Hampshire should be, the addict's willingness factor is important, too. Just the fact that an addict is willing to reside in Drug Rehab for a prolonged period of time, is a good signthat they truly desire to get better.
